IP查询
查询
你查询的IP:[114.80.189.130] 地理位置:中国–上海–上海电信/IDC机房
最新查询
118.126.138.128
118.64.54.34
123.244.16.0
123.56.74.97
119.28.84.221
119.229.209.212
122.198.76.57
221.199.62.36
222.128.92.17
118.224.70.71
120.94.110.195
114.80.189.130
221.199.224.231
166.111.175.76
123.148.128.126
210.23.32.151
122.156.117.171
120.80.78.161
123.199.128.141
203.223.11.210
123.137.253.114
202.38.146.159
124.88.111.138
202.90.252.22
124.147.128.142
202.92.252.51
203.223.25.199
120.92.249.95
203.91.32.110
60.63.30.188
202.122.152.74
124.224.164.28
222.168.161.143